As we all know, the random wind, gust, and the uncertainty caused the frequency and voltage of the electric power from the wind power unit, this electric energy is lack of use except for the electric installations
which have low-rise need for electric energy like heaters, we need to control and set the quality of the electric energy, the methods in common used are: constant speed constant frequency, variable speed constant frequency,
variable frequency control. The VSCF control method can not only control the quality of the electric energy, and also can capture the wind energy furthest, the active and reactive power can be independently adjusted by
decoupling control, and restrain harmonic, reduce the cost. The VSCF control projects we often use are: Asynchronous generator system, the exchange-fed generator excitation system, BDFM generator system,
permanent magnet generator system. Because the electronic equipment of the double-fed electrical generator play the pole only in the control loop, equipment capacity generally should not exceed 30% of the power output of
wind energy conversion system. The cost of equipment can be significantly reduced. Thus BDFM is a kind of wind energy conversion methods which have good prospect. BDFM, got rid of the slide loop and brush which
can be easily attrited, improved the reliability of wind energy conversion system.
